Shadowsocks使用教程:详细指南与常见问题解答

什么是Shadowsocks?

Shadowsocks是一种轻量级的代理工具,通常用于突破网络限制,实现更自由的上网体验。其主要特点包括:

  • 快速:Shadowsocks采用了多种加密方式,传输速度快。
  • 安全:使用加密技术来保护用户的隐私。
  • 简单:易于安装和配置,适合各种用户。

Shadowsocks的工作原理

Shadowsocks通过创建一个加密的通道,将用户的网络请求转发到指定的服务器,从而达到隐藏用户真实IP和访问被限制网站的目的。具体流程如下:

  1. 用户在本地安装Shadowsocks客户端。
  2. 客户端将用户的请求通过加密通道发送到Shadowsocks服务器。
  3. 服务器解密请求并转发到目标网站。
  4. 目标网站的响应通过同样的路径返回给用户。

如何安装Shadowsocks?

Windows系统下安装Shadowsocks

  1. Shadowsocks官网下载Windows版客户端。
  2. 解压下载的文件,并运行 Shadowsocks.exe
  3. 在任务栏中找到Shadowsocks图标,右键单击并选择“服务器设置”。
  4. 输入Shadowsocks服务器的信息,包括地址、端口、密码和加密方式。
  5. 点击“确定”保存设置,并在右键菜单中选择“启用代理”。

Mac系统下安装Shadowsocks

  1. 下载并安装ShadowsocksX-NG客户端。
  2. 打开ShadowsocksX-NG,点击菜单栏图标并选择“偏好设置”。
  3. 添加服务器信息,包括服务器地址、端口、密码和加密方式。
  4. 确保“自动代理配置”被选中。

Linux系统下安装Shadowsocks

  1. 使用终端安装Shadowsocks客户端,命令如下: bash sudo apt-get install shadowsocks

  2. 编辑配置文件 config.json,加入服务器信息。

  3. 使用命令启动Shadowsocks: bash sslocal -c /etc/shadowsocks/config.json

安卓和iOS设备下安装Shadowsocks

  1. 在Google Play商店或Apple App Store搜索“Shadowsocks”并下载安装。
  2. 打开应用并添加服务器信息。
  3. 启用代理后即可使用。

Shadowsocks配置详解

配置文件结构

Shadowsocks的配置文件一般采用JSON格式,主要包含以下字段:

  • server: 服务器地址
  • server_port: 服务器端口
  • password: 连接密码
  • method: 加密方式

常用加密方法

  • aes-256-gcm: 性能与安全性兼顾,推荐使用。
  • aes-128-cfb: 性能较好,适合带宽较低的用户。
  • chacha20: 适合移动设备,速度快。

常见问题解答(FAQ)

1. Shadowsocks的使用是否合法?

使用Shadowsocks本身并不违法,但使用时要遵守当地法律法规。某些国家或地区对网络代理工具有严格限制,建议用户自行了解相关法律。

2. 如何选择合适的Shadowsocks服务器?

选择服务器时,可以参考以下几点:

  • 地理位置:选择距离自己较近的服务器以提高速度。
  • 稳定性:可参考用户评价或进行测速。
  • 安全性:选择有信誉的服务提供商以确保数据安全。

3. Shadowsocks能绕过哪些网络限制?

Shadowsocks可以有效绕过很多地区的网络限制,包括社交媒体、视频流媒体等。但某些高级防火墙可能会检测到Shadowsocks流量,建议结合使用其他工具。

4. Shadowsocks与VPN有什么区别?

  • 技术实现:Shadowsocks是代理工具,VPN则是通过建立加密隧道来实现流量保护。
  • 使用场景:Shadowsocks适合轻量使用,VPN适合全面保护网络隐私。

5. 如何优化Shadowsocks的使用体验?

  • 定期更换服务器:避免被封锁。
  • 选择合适的加密方式:根据带宽情况选择适合的加密方法。
  • 使用混淆技术:提高流量隐蔽性,避免被检测。

结论

Shadowsocks作为一款优秀的代理工具,为用户提供了更自由和安全的上网方式。通过以上详细的使用教程和常见问题解答,希望能帮助用户更好地理解和使用Shadowsocks。无论是安装、配置还是使用过程中遇到的问题,本文都尽量涵盖了大部分信息,期待你在Shadowsocks的世界中畅游无阻!

正文完